A Meta-analysis of recurrent infections prevalence of hand-foot-and-mouth disease among children in China

  • Objective To estimate the prevalence of recurrent infection of hand-foot-and-mouth disease (HFMD) by Metaanalysis.Methods By using Chinese Web of Knowledge,Wanfang,Weipu,PubMed,and Web of Science databases,a systematic literature search with keywords included ("repeated infection" OR recurred OR reoccurrence OR "multiple infection" OR "multiple infection" OR "reinfection" OR "reoccurring infection" OR "recurrent infection") AND ("HFMD" OR "hand-foot-and-mouth Disease") AND "rate" both in Chinese and English.The quality of each paper was evaluated with "critical appraisal of the health research literature:prevalence or incidence of a health problem".Random-effects Meta-analysis was used to estimate recurrent infection prevalence of HFMD by comprehensive Meta-analysis.Subgroup analyses were conducted by study years,study location,publication year,sample size,standard of repeated infection,repeated infection times,gratitude and average temperature per year to explore the heterogeneity.Egger test were performed to evaluate the publication bias.Sensitivity analysis was evaluated by iteratively removing one study at a time and comparing the recalculated combined estimates.Results Thirty-one studies were included in the analysis.The combined prevalence of recurrent infection of HFMD was 2.25% (95%CI=1.59%-3.18%).Cochran's Q test showed a high degree of heterogeneity across studies(I2=99.87,P =0.000).Subgroup analysis estimated that the heterogeneity had a certain distinction at the indexes of sample size,study years,standard of repeated infection,repeated infection times,gratitude and average temperature per year.Conclusion Significant regional differences in recurrent infection of HFMD are found across China.Further investigation should focus on the sources of heterogeneity.
